No. 16 IU Captures Sixth Straight Dale England Cup
4/29/2023 1:49:00 PM | Women's Rowing
BLOOMINGTON, Ind. – No. 16-ranked Indiana rowing won six of seven races Saturday (April 29) morning to win the Dale England Cup for a sixth straight year at its home facility, the Dale England Rowing Center, on Lake Lemon.

NOTES
- Of the 14 times in has been contested, Indiana has won seven Dale England Cup trophies.
- The Big Ten Boat of the Week, Indiana's Varsity Eight, clinched the cup in a time of 6:33.3, 8.1 seconds faster than Notre Dame.
- Eight seniors raced for the final time at Lake Lemon: Sophie Carmosino, Laura Feinson, Rachael Galet, Erin Heapy, Nicole Killeen, Libby Krueger, Ruby Leverington and Olivia Seifert.
- IU's Third Varsity Four had the largest margin of victory, winning by 21.9 seconds.
- IU won all but the first event, the 2N8/4V8 event, in which they finished 1.1 seconds behind.
Prior to racing, head coach Steve Peterson and IU rowing dedicated a new racing four-oared shell after alumnus Sophia Wickersham, a four-year rower from 2016-19.
RESULTS
| V8 1. Indiana 6:33.3 (18) 2. Notre Dame 6:41.4 (9) |
| 2V8 1. Indiana 6:54.7 (12) 2. Notre Dame 6:59.6 (6) |
| V4 1. Indiana 7:33.7 (6) 2. Notre Dame 7:38.6 (3) |
| 2V4 1. Indiana 7:38.3 2. Notre Dame 7:42.6 |
| 3V4 1. Indiana 8:00.0 2. Notre Dame 8:21.9 |
| N8 1. Indiana 6:55.0 2. Notre Dame 7:00.6 |
| 2N8 1. Notre Dame 7:23.4 2. Indiana 7:24.5 |
